The Proposal 

Heidelberg Materials is proposing to resume and intensify operations at the Underwood Quarry, located off Lilydale Road, approximately 12 kilometres north of Launceston. The proposal involves a production increase from a previously permitted limit of 93,750 cubic metres of dolerite rock (noting that the quarry is currently in care and maintenance) to 143,750 cubic metres of gravel per year, and includes the crushing and screening of extracted material. The activity will incorporate the recycling of up to 28,000 cubic metres. All extractive activity is to take place within the existing permitted footprint.​​

Environmental Impact Statement Guidelines

EIS Guidelines have been prepared by the Board to assist the proponent to prepare a case for assessment. Based on the information contained in the Notice of Intent/Development Application, the guidelines identify the key issues which are expected to be relevant to the assessment of the proposal.
